2. Parts Required and Quality Used

Garage door parts are not all created equal. Using low-grade springs, cheap rollers, or non-rated cables might reduce the immediate bill but can lead to repeat failures and additional service calls. 5. Door Size, Weight, and Design

The size and configuration of your garage door significantly affect repair pricing. A single-car aluminum door with standard height and weight is faster and cheaper to repair than a custom double-door, insulated steel door, or heavy wood carriage-style door.

Spring Replacement

Broken springs are one of the most common garage door failures in Redland. A spring may snap after years of service or when a door is out of balance. Because springs support the door’s weight, they are under high tension and are extremely dangerous to replace without proper training and tools.

Professional spring replacement in Redland typically reflects:

  • Inspection of both springs (for dual-spring systems)
  • Use of properly rated torsion or extension springs
  • Balancing the door and confirming smooth motion
  • Safety checks on cables, drums, and mounts

Expect a higher cost if you have a heavier, oversize, or custom door requiring premium springs.

Track, Roller, and Cable Repairs

Damage to tracks, rollers, or lift cables is especially common when a door hits an obstruction, gets bumped by a vehicle, or has been operating with poor alignment. In Redland, where driveways can slope or curve, misalignment issues sometimes arise from uneven movement or impact.

Typical services include:

  • Straightening or replacing bent tracks
  • Replacing worn or seized rollers with quieter, smoother options
  • Replacing frayed or broken lift cables
  • Realigning the door and confirming travel limits

Pricing depends on how many components must be replaced and whether there is any secondary damage to the door or opener.

Panel and Section Replacement

A single dented or cracked panel—often from a backing car or sports equipment—does not always require replacing the entire door. When the door model is still supported by manufacturers, technicians can often replace one or more individual panels.

The cost will depend on:

  • Material (steel, aluminum, wood, composite)
  • Insulation level and thickness
  • Whether the panel is custom or standard
  • Color-matching and trim style requirements

In some cases, especially with older or severely damaged doors, full replacement may offer better value than extensive section repairs.

How can I tell if my garage door spring is broken or about to fail?

Signs of a failing or broken spring include a door that will not open fully, an opener that strains or stops, a visible gap in the torsion spring above the door, or a sudden loud snapping sound from the garage. How often should I schedule garage door maintenance in Redland MD?

For most homes in Redland MD, annual professional maintenance is a sensible baseline, particularly if the garage door is used multiple times per day. During a maintenance visit, a trained technician can lubricate moving parts, tighten hardware, check spring balance, inspect cables and rollers, and verify opener safety features.
